Transaction d6030614332befbfd94e6b54c417e16bcd2ddcd76b148923aa4b7a22dd0ffbfa

1 Input
2 Outputs
  • d6030614332befbfd94e6b54c417e16bcd2ddcd76b148923aa4b7a22dd0ffbfa:0
  • value  3091107
    address  38LbeH25DPEpePCWB7HDqqFQPuFH4zPLqK
  • d6030614332befbfd94e6b54c417e16bcd2ddcd76b148923aa4b7a22dd0ffbfa:1
  • value  7903946
    address  39xxFcmZTc5NXmeh6VpSVfoprvckcpsHqD